Output e2c370133f2a33e337e99613700cd67e52cf1b7d2e877ccfe6e1df406588343c:65

value
14808612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1b8a1d2db25539a87ad798925729191c9e456f1 OP_EQUAL
address
3LovL6pZT9o5LDrtoBn3JdmWEj8wBymuDn
transaction
e2c370133f2a33e337e99613700cd67e52cf1b7d2e877ccfe6e1df406588343c
confirmations
276072
spent
true